Question- We ask if there is an authority for the claim of Bishop M. Lamparter to be S.G.M.A. of the O.T.O.A.?
Answer- The almanach does not recognize that Bishop Lamparter was consecrated S.G.M.A. of the O.T.O.A. This is based on the following documents:
1.) Document: February 20, 1976 Bertiaux appoints M. Lamparter as S.G. inspector general(33?) for the grand hierophant ( Bertiaux ) but he was invited to visit the U.S.A. To receive proper ritualistic initiation and consecration to the appropriate grade(33rd.) (rite A & P of M.M. Source).
2.) Document: November 6, 1981, letter of appointment of M. Lamparter as S.G.M. effective 1-1-1982 from Ken Ward. Note: Ken Ward was to take a year long retirement.
A.) M. Bertiaux was appointed by Ken Ward to be S.G.M.A., therefore leading to M. Lamparter's appointment as S.G.M.
B.) Ken Ward said that after a year of retirement, he would resume the position of S.G.M.A. in an advisory sense.
3.) Document: May 2, 1982- Ancient and Primitive Memphis-Misraim document of Nevio Viola to M. Lamparter, wherein Viola as the S.G.M.A. of the Rite of Memphis-Misraim (Misraim Order) gives to M. Lamparter authority to represent the Italian Sovereign Sanctuary of the Gnosis of Italy in Spain as S.G.M. as well as the same for the Italian O.T.O. (O.T.O.I.) N. Viola's Italian Gnostic O.T.O.-independent of the O.T.O.A. and the major O.T.O. groups.
4.) Document: Pansophic document from N. Viola to M. Lamparter= May 2, 1982
wherein M. Lamparter is appointed as the G.M. of the O.T.O.A. in Spain, of
the Pansophic Society, which is rank of G.M. in the Pansophic Society, an all inclusive union historically connected to ' 93 current orders'.
5.)Document: June 7, 1982= M. Lamparter to Nevio Viola, wherein Lamparter
as S.G.M. of the O.T.O.A. recognizes Nevio Viola as the representative of the
O.T.O.A. in Italy of Lamparter's jurisdiction.
6.)Document: February 28, 1983= letter from Nevio Viola to Lamparter,
wherein M. Lamparter is addressed as S.G.M. of the O.T.O.A.
7.) Document- August 16, 1985= M. Lamparter as S.G.M. x? of the O.T.O.A. ,to Paolo Fogagnolo, in which Fogagnolo is appointed as general secretary of the O.T.O.A. .for Italy. Note = Lamparter states that M. Bertiaux is the S.G.M.A. of the O.T.O.A. , in the Inner Retreat in Chicago, USA., and that Bertiaux has supreme authority over all the Sovereign Sanctuaries of the Gnosis of the O.T.O.A.
8.)Document- September 8, 1989= from Courtney Willis as S.G.M. to Nevio Viola,
in which C. Willis authorizes Nevio Viola to head the Italian O.T.O.A. under the
direction of C. Willis.
9.)Document- Kunst-Opus IX- Strasburg, 1995= Article on L'ordo Templi
Orientis Antiqua in which Joel Duez confirms that in 1994 he was consecrated
in person to be the Grand Master of the O.T.O.A. for France and the French
speaking countries by Michael Bertiaux.
QUESTION: Then where did Bishop Lamparter come by his belief he had been consecrated the S.G.M.A. of the O.T.O.A.?
ANSWER: The almanach believes that Bishop Manuel C. Lamparter arrived at his S.G.M.A. position from his Memphis-Misraim work with Nevio Viola (Document 3) and from his pansophic work with Nevio Viola (document 4) which led to Lamparter's development of a pansophic interpretation of the rank of S.G.M.A., rather than a Voudoun- Gnostic/O.T.O.A. interpretation of the rank.
QUESTION: Does Bishop Lamparter possess any O.T.O.A. authority from the consecration of Joel Duez by Michael Bertiaux in 1994?
ANSWER: It would not be possible for Bishop Lamparter to receive any authority
in Spain from Joel Duez, because Duez's O.T.O.A. jurisdiction was restricted to France and French-speaking countries.
QUESTION: Therefore, how does the Almanach regard the claims of Bishop Lamparter?
ANSWER: The Almanach denies all claims of Bishop Lamparter. The Almanach of the
O.T.O.A. ( Almanach de Bertiaux ) has determined that Courtney Willis is
the consecrated Sovereign Grand Master Absolute of the O.T.O.A.,
absolutely.
